Which one of these is not like the others:

  • That's so dumb.
  • That's so stupid.
  • That's so annoying.
  • That's so gay.

It may look obvious typed out, but often times it doesn't sound that way. That's why some Duke students are taking matters into their own hands:

The above photos come from the You Don’t Say? campaign at Duke University, run by campus group Think Before You Talk and student-led LGBTQ organization Blue Devils United.
